In the early 1900s, as the Panama Canal is being built, a group of doctors try to discover a cure for yellow fever, a disease that is decimating the workers constructing the canal.
2017
2015
1999
2013
2003
2011
2025
1975
2024
2020
2018
—
2021
2012
1912